I compiled Phalcon using the instructions on the site, added extension = phalcon.so to the end of my php.ini file. I restarted the server but when I run print_r(get_loaded_extensions());

Phalcon isn't there.

I'm using nginx on Ubuntu, if that matters.

Have you enabled the extension in your php.ini configuration?

extension = /usr/lib/php5/20090626/phalcon.so

That is I believe the path of where the extension will be compiled in a Ubuntu box.

Restart the server after that or in your case php_fpm :)

  • The key is that you are using Ubuntu which I am too. You can always see the path of where the extension is installed at the output of the compilation process. I believe it is when issuing sudo make install
